T20 World Cup, India vs Namibia Live Score Online Updates: India signed off their disappointing T20 World Cup campaign with a nine-wicket win over Namibia here on Monday. India reached the target of 133 in 15.2 overs with Rohit Sharma (56) and KL Rahul (54 not out) stitching 86 runs for the opening stand to set up the win in their final Super 12 match. Suryakumar Yadav also remained not out on 25. For Namibia, Jan Frylinck took one wicket.

Earlier, India restricted Namibia to 132 for 8. Invited to bat, Namibia struggled to get going and they suffered a batting collapse after an opening stand of 33 between Stephan Baard (21) and Michael van Lingen (14). David Wiese top-scored for Namibia with a 25-ball 26. For India, Ravichandran Ashwin and Ravindra Jadeja took three wickets apiece while Jasprit Bumrah got two. This match is the last for Virat Kohli as India captain in T20 Internationals while Ravi Shashtri is donning the head coach’s hat for the last time.

Brief Scores:

Namibia: 132 for 8 in 20 overs (David Wiese 26; Ravindra Jadeja 3/16, Ravichandran Ashwin 3/20).

India: 136 for 1 in 15.2 overs (Rohit Sharma 56; KL Rahul 54 not out; Jan Frylinck 1/19).

Outgoing captain Virat Kohli speaks

'Relief firstly (on leaving T20I captaincy). It's been a honor but things need to be kept at the right perspective. I felt this was the right time to manage my workload. It's been six or seven years of heavy workload and there is a lot of pressure. The guys have been fantastic, I know we haven't got the results here but we have played some really good cricket. The guys have really made my work easier. The way we played the last three games, it's a game of margins - T20 cricket these days. Two overs of attacking cricket at the top is what we were missing in the first two games. As I said, we weren't brave enough in those games and in the group we were in, it was tough. A big thank you to all those guys (Ravi Shastri and his support staff). They have done a great job over the years, creating such a wonderful environment for the players. People loved to get back to the atmosphere. They have done a really great job. That (his aggression) is never going to change. The day it does, I'll stop playing cricket. Even before I became captain, I have always loved to contribute in some way or the other. Surya didn't get much gametime in this World Cup, so I thought it will be a nice memory to take back. That was the idea (behind not batting himself).'

Spark missing from academic encounter

Any match involving Team India is never low-key, but the game against Namibia came as close as any. With nothing other than pride and statistics riding on the fixture, it had an end-of-semester feel about it. The side looked flat in the field with very little chatter. Maybe, after being ousted from the tournament, the superstars of world cricket had trouble lifting themselves for a game against proverbial minnows. It was mirrored in the large number of empty seats at the Dubai International Stadium, a rare phenomenon for the Indian team. Not that it made much difference in the actual match. Namibia have shown shades of potential during the tournament, but after a promising start – a six over wide long-on by Stephan Baard off Mohammed Shami was a stroke to savour – they started losing wickets. When this scenario plays out, the underdog team generally tries to make full use of the overs rather than going for a high-risk approach. The fancied side is the one which has to force the issue, but given the situation India had very little incentive to go for the jugular.
